You are looking at a very nice 1954 Chevrolet ½ ton Deluxe Pickup Truck. This truck is running a healthy 350 4-bolt main engine with about 4000 miles on it since a rebuild by a racing engine machinist with 30 years of experience. The engine was line bored with a torque plate 0.30 over, making it a 355 cubic inch and balanced. It has double-hump heads casting number: 3917291, with new stainless steel valves. It has a COMP hydraulic roller cam and kit. The engine is coupled to a rebuilt 700rR4 transmission with a C40 GM torque converter. TV cable has been adjusted professionally for correct lockup and shifting up and down. New U joints and balanced drive line. The shifter is a Lokar polished aluminum shifter with working neutral safety switch The exhaust is 2 ½-inch pipe with rams horn exhaust manifolds extending beyond the back bumper with crossover H-pipe and turbo mufflers. The brake system is drum with all moving parts replaced with premium linings, NOS master cylinder, new fluid, new flexible and steel lines and emergency brake cables. Emergency brake works. The wheels are American Racing Torque-Thrust Ds 15 x 7-inch on the front and 15 x 8.5-inch on the rear with Schwab Premium Sport radials staggered sizes. The tires on the front are new. New custom harness throughout, installed by Master Auto electrician and community college automotive instructor using an American Auto Wire hand-built loom. The truck has courtesy cab lights, turn indicator lamps in the dashboard, electric two-speed wipers, individual junction wire separations under the hood, modern relays, switches, and emergency flashers. The tail lamps are LED units set in stainless steel original housings. Parking lights have been changed to amber lenses for greater visibility. The gas tank is a new replacement model with reproduction tank straps and hardware. The tank sender is new as is the fuel gauge with a new generic electric fuel pump mounted on the frame with two disposable filters at the tank. Steel IDID-IT steering column with tilt and flashers painted body color. The steering wheel is a 15-inch 1956 Bel Air with De Luxe chrome horn ring and hub crest. The interior hardware, visors, armrests, and fasteners have all been replaced. The seat is a factory option Unison model, which was a heavy-duty cab over truck comfort design, with air control under the seat. Gauges are Stewart-Warner 2 1/8-inch traditional logo models mounted in a custom, brushed aluminum panel. The tachometer is a late 1960s SUN “Football” model due to the red seal on the face of the unit that has been converted to solid state internals. The factory option clock over the instrument cluster is a manual, wind-up unit. The heater and cigar lighter work well. Heater blower is a 3 speed with factory switch below the dash. The upholstery was installed during the original build and a new headliner was installed recently. The driver’s side seat was redone with new foaming for support as well as new carpeting and kick pads. Three seat belts are installed with Grade 8 hardware. The cab and the frame is rust free as is the bed and rear fenders. The floor and roof of the cab have several layers of sound and heat insulation. The running boards are in nice shape and powder coated with all new fasteners. The windshield and side glass are new with factory tint as original. All window channels, fasteners, rubbers fuzzies and door handles are new .Cab weather strips, fender welting, door and floor weather stripping, dome light, and rubber strips between the cab and running boards are new The bed boards are Red Oak. They have 11 coats of spar varnish on both sides, with hand sanding between coats. All of the fasteners and wood trim strips are polished stainless steel. The bed chains and covers were replaced along with the rear bumper and all of the bolts. The license plate light and bracket are new as well. The spare tire mount is a factory option and is covered with an accessory body color continental kit plate and stainless steel tire cover with a padlock hasp under the bottom. The rim fits the bolt pattern on the wheels and has a good spare mounted. This truck was ordered as a De Luxe model that included a number of options: § All glass tinted § Radio block off plate in lower dashboard § Outside rear view mirror on driver’s door § Clock-over gauge cluster in the dashboard wind-up works § Heater and defroster recirculating or Air Flow § Lamp on the right side tail § Cigarette lighter § Bird hood ornament § Rest arm molded sponge rubber on driver’s and passenger door § Traffic signal light viewer § Directional signals § Stainless vent shades § Outside visor § Windshield washer nozzles on cowling, entire NOS factory system included but not installed § Right side sun visor § Matching high note horn unit § Ride control seat (Unison) air ride control from COE truck series § Cab corner windows § Stainless window trim in rubber moldings § Chrome grille § Chrome rear bumper We have the receipts and plenty of documentation for all the work performed by professionals on this truck. The outside paint was restored ten years ago, and it still looks very good with a nice shine. The interior paint work was done by an amateur and doesn’t match the craftsmanship of the exterior.
